Huddersfield claimed their first league win at Bradford for 40 years to continue their bright start under new coach Nathan Brown. The Giants made a slow start and three early Paul Deacon penalties put the Bulls into a 6-0 lead. But tries from Martin Aspinwall and Jamahl Lolesi edged the Giants ahead by the break. Glenn Morrison's effort, converted by Deacon, restored the Bulls' lead, but Stephen Wild's try proved the winner. Brett Hodgson got stand-off Kevin Brown through a gap in the Bulls defence and the second-rower was in support to finish off. Hodgson's second conversion made it 16-12, but it was the home side who dominated the final quarter. Huddersfield's defence was tested to the limit, with Steve Menzies going close for the Bulls, but the visitors hung on to claim the spoils.
